....appears that the doubt has been raised on account of the words, "those headings" mentioned in Chapter Note 6 to Chapter 85 of the Customs Tariff. A plain reading of Note 6 as it stands, makes it amply clear that the reference to "those headings" in this Chapter Note refers to headings "85.23 or 85.24" and not to the headings of the equipment/apparatus.
